Chehalem Glenn Golf Club
About
Chehalem Glenn Golf Club sprawls across beautifully hilly terrain, providing a course that is not for the faint of heart. The course is defined by the dramatic changes in elevation, which can make it tough to walk. The steep hills make this a tough golf course even for high handicappers. Uphill, downhill, and sidehill lies abound and you'll also face forced carries to narrow landing areas as well as blind layup shots. The more open front nine is player friendly and the back nine is where it gets tougher with mostly tree-lined holes and more strategically placed bunkers. The golf course is as scenic as it is challenging with elevated tees and greens that overlooks the surrounding hills and valleys. The beauty and difficulty of the course has built Chehalem Glenn Golf Club a reputation as one of the greater Portland area's must-play courses.

Take a cart!
- Friendly and helpful staff, and clean freshly charged carts
- Decent practice range (no grass, just mats), and putting greens
- Carts are $15 (seems high to me but I usually walk)...This time I paid for a cart as Chehalem Glenn is not a very walkable course due to hilly terrain, especially 6, 9-12, and 14 with some long stretches between a few greens and the next tee
- Pace of play was reasonable (3hr 2-some on Fri morning, 8-11am), and a Marshall was out on patrol to manage pace of groups on front and back 9s
- Plenty of poison oak here, so stay out of the woods
- I enjoyed all the holes here ... even 9-11, which just feel and look odd to my eye
- Cool off on the shaded patio after the round
- Greens were in good shape but kinda slow, and many bunkers are in a state of ‘ground under repair’
